Commercial Grade vs. Residential Umbrellas: Why Standard Patio Umbrellas Fail

In a bustling restaurant dining environment, outdoor shading infrastructure is subjected to continuous mechanical wear, frequent adjustments by untrained staff, unpredictable wind shear, and severe UV radiation. Installing residential umbrellas in a commercial setting creates serious operational risks and financial drag.

Residential Umbrellas (High Failure Risk)

  • Thin-walled aluminum or soft wood poles prone to snap under 15–20 mph gusts.
  • Piece-dyed polyester fabrics that fade and lose tear strength within 6–12 months.
  • Plastic hand-cranks and internal cords that fray after repetitive daily commercial cycling.
  • Request documentation for the intended installation and operating conditions; residential or commercial labels alone do not establish site suitability.

Commercial Grade Umbrellas (Hospitality Standard)

  • 6063-T5 architectural extruded aluminum with reinforced internal ribbing.
  • Fabric performance: Compare the selected textile's documented UV protection, lightfastness, care instructions and written warranty. These vary by fabric range.
  • Heavy-duty pin-and-pulley or commercial gear-driven telescopic opening mechanisms.
  • Wind limits: Obtain the rating and operating instructions for the exact canopy, base and mounting configuration. No single wind speed applies to all commercial umbrellas.

The 3 Core Types of Commercial Restaurant Umbrellas

Selecting the correct mechanical configuration depends directly on your floor layout, seating density goals, and ground anchor feasibility.

1. Commercial Market Umbrellas (Center Pole)

The traditional center-pole market umbrella remains the workhorse of bistro and sidewalk cafe dining. Designed to pass directly through the center hole of a dining table into a weighted floor base, this design provides maximum structural symmetry. The downforce of the table adds auxiliary stability, making it exceptionally resilient against localized wind gusts.

2. Cantilever / Offset Commercial Umbrellas

When evaluating a cantilever vs market umbrella for commercial use, offset models excel in modular flexibility. By positioning the heavy support mast completely outside the dining perimeter, cantilever umbrellas suspend the canopy overhead without obstructing floor space. This configuration is ideal for flexible lounge seating, communal fire pits, or continuous banquet table setups where center poles are impractical.

3. Heavy-Duty Telescopic Giant Umbrellas

For large commercial outdoor terraces requiring expansive individual shade spans (ranging from 13x13 ft up to 20x20 ft), giant telescopic umbrellas provide venue-grade coverage. Utilizing a internal rack-and-pinion telescopic system, the canopy collar rises upward as it closes, allowing the perimeter arms to collapse cleanly above table-top height without requiring servers to move dinnerware or furniture.

Engineering Specifications: 4 Non-Negotiable Quality Standards

To guarantee a multi-year return on investment, specify these four technical material standards in your commercial procurement request:

  1. Architectural Extruded Aluminum (6063-T5 Alloy): Refuse thin stamped aluminum tubing. Commercial frames should feature heavy-gauge extruded aluminum poles with a minimum wall thickness of 2.5mm to 4.0mm, finished with an electrostatic powder coating to prevent corrosion in coastal air or high-humidity regions.
  2. Solution-dyed acrylic canopy textiles: Pigment is incorporated during fibre manufacture. Check the selected fabric's test method, lightfastness result, water-repellency treatment and maintenance instructions; do not assume one fabric range represents every canopy.
  3. Structural Mounting Infrastructure: Mobile floor bases relying solely on gravity require extreme weight (150–300 lbs) in commercial settings. For permanent dining plazas, specify in-ground concrete sleeves or surface-mounted steel anchor plates flush-bolted directly into reinforced concrete slabs.
  4. Dual-Vented Dynamic Wind Canopies: Single-piece canvas tops collect rising air currents like a sail. Commercial canopies must feature high-flow wind escape vents (or multi-tier canopy caps) to relieve internal air pressure under sudden atmospheric wind shear.

Calculating Restaurant Table Clearance & Shade Coverage (ROI)

To calculate the correct umbrella size, follow the 2-Foot Overhang Rule. A commercial canopy must extend at least 2 feet (24 inches) beyond the edge of the dining table on all sides to properly shield diners from low-angle afternoon sun and solar heat glare.

  • Standard 36" Square 4-Person Table: Requires an 8.5 ft to 10 ft octagonal or square canopy.
  • Rectangular 6-Person Dining Table: Requires an 8x10 ft or 10x12 ft rectangular commercial canopy.
  • Walkway & Server Clearance: Ensure the lower edge of the canopy rib maintains a minimum vertical clearance of 7 feet (84 inches) above the ground to allow waitstaff and guests to walk underneath safely without stooping.

Frequently Asked Questions

What size commercial umbrella do I need for a 4-person restaurant table?

A standard 4-person restaurant table (36-inch to 42-inch top) requires an 8.5-foot to 10-foot umbrella canopy. This provides the necessary 2-foot shade margin around the perimeter, ensuring all seated guests remain shielded from UV rays as the sun shifts throughout meal service.

Can commercial outdoor umbrellas stay open during high wind events?

Use only the operating limits specified for the exact umbrella, canopy size, base and anchoring arrangement. Close and secure it before adverse weather and when unattended. If wind conditions or site exposure are uncertain, keep it closed and obtain supplier guidance; do not use a generic wind-speed threshold.

How long do commercial-grade restaurant umbrellas typically last?

Service life varies with the selected materials, site exposure, use, installation and maintenance. Request the written warranty for each component and confirm replacement-fabric and spare-part availability; an expected service life is not a warranty.
